Transferred to Oregon to utilize his final season of collegiate elgibility in 2006-07 and enrolled for winter term. Previously competed for Radford University (2003-04, '04-05, '05-06) and the University of Detroit (2002-03). Earned All-America honors as a junior in 2005 in hammer, and indoors in 2006 in the weight throw. Ranked 15th in the U.S. in the hammer as a redshirt junior for Radford in 2006 (PR 223-3).
Before Oregon: Ranked sixth among collegians during season thanks to his hammer personal best (223-3) - more than 15 better than his 2005 season best (207-8) that came in the NCAA prelims and ranked him 45th in the U.S. Earned All-America honors in 2005 NCAA Championships as a junior (10th, 201-0 / 207-8-prelims), while his previous season best (207-3) ranked him 23rd on the collegiate list before the NCAA meet. Also scored All-America indoors in 2006 in the weight throw (eighth, 69-3 1/2) after he ranked 14th among collegians prior to the meet with his personal and season best (69-4 1/4). As a sophomore for Radford initially set weight throw school record (57-4 3/4), then redshirted outdoor season (2004). As a freshman at Detroit Mercy, placed third in the 2003 Horizon League Outdoor Championships in the discus and hammer after he redshirted the indoor season. High School (Coach): Royal Oak Shrine Catholic '02 (Wilson).
Prep: State championships qualifier in the discus as a senior. Four-year letterwinner in track and field, and also lettered multiple years in football (3) as a defensive end and offensive lineman and in basketball (2) as a forward. His football team won the Catholic leage title in 2000 and '01. Honor roll and National Honor Society member.
